Sri Lanka to Bolivia by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Sri Lanka to Bolivia by plane will take about 1 day 11h and departs from Bandaranaike International Colombo Airport (CMB) and arrives into Viru Viru International Airport (VVI). There are flights departing every 1-2 days on this route. Emirates is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ing every 1-2 days.

Sri Lanka to Bolivia by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Sri Lanka to Bolivia by ship will take about 44 days 2h and departs from Colombo (LKCMB) and arrives into Paita (PEPAI). There are vessels departing every 2-4 weeks on this route. CMA CGM is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 2-4 weeks.
